Objetivo del tema
Contrastar Codex CLI con otras soluciones de IA para desarrollo, destacar las fortalezas del enfoque en terminal y analizar cómo combinarlas efectivamente.
El ecosistema de agentes y asistentes crece rápidamente. Esta guía se centra en Codex CLI y tres propuestas populares: Copilot CLI, Claude Code y Gemini CLI.
Extensión de GitHub CLI que transforma lenguaje natural en comandos explicados y seguros.
Agente de Anthropic para terminal y VS Code; automatiza refactors, pruebas y flujos de Git.
CLI abierta de Google que conecta con Gemini 2.5 Pro, con búsqueda, MCP y ejecución asistida.
Agente local con control granular de sandbox, ideal para flujos reproducibles y auditables.
| Característica | Codex CLI | Copilot CLI | Claude Code | Gemini CLI |
|---|---|---|---|---|
| Ejecución | Local con sandbox configurable; permite comandos reales en tu repo. | Extensión de gh que propone y ejecuta comandos desde lenguaje natural. |
CLI y panel en VS Code que orquesta agentes de Anthropic para editar y ejecutar tareas. | CLI Node.js que enlaza con Gemini y habilita herramientas como shell, archivos o web. |
| Control de cambios | Panel de diffs en la TUI y aprobaciones paso a paso. | Respuestas en consola con comandos sugeridos y explicaciones; no gestiona diffs propios. | Comandos como /fix generan parches revisables y flujos de PR desde el CLI. |
Checkpointing de conversaciones y uso de GEMINI.md para contexto versionado. |
| Sandbox / permisos | Modos read-only, workspace-write, danger-full-access. | Usa los permisos del shell y GitHub CLI; sin sandbox dedicado. | Solicita confirmación antes de ejecutar acciones en tu repo local o remoto. | Login con Google o API key y autorización por herramienta (búsqueda, shell, etc.). |
| Integraciones | CLI + IDEs (VS Code, Cursor, Windsurf) + GitHub Action. | GitHub CLI, Copilot Workspace y workflows de repos en GitHub. | Terminal, extensión VS Code y menciones @claude en GitHub. | MCP servers, Google Cloud, GitHub Action y Google Search grounding. |
| Uso ideal | Desarrolladores técnicos que quieren reproducibilidad y registro. | Equipos que traducen pedidos a comandos de shell/GitHub sin salir de la terminal. | Colaboración en VS Code con asistencia de Claude para refactors complejos. | Flujos que requieren multimodalidad Gemini y automatización multiplataforma. |
Codex CLI se destaca cuando necesitas:
codex exec permite scripts reproducibles en CI/CD.config.toml para alternar rápidamente entre configuraciones (por ejemplo, profiles.full_auto vs. profiles.readonly_quiet).
/fix dentro de VS Code y valida los resultados con pruebas y diffs en Codex.Elige la herramienta según el objetivo de cada etapa. A menudo conviene empezar en el CLI para obtener un registro claro y luego pasar al IDE para retoques menores.
Codex CLI complementa el ecosistema de IA al ofrecer control total sobre el flujo de desarrollo. Comparte protagonismo con asistentes en IDE y plataformas colaborativas, y se potencia cuando se integra en estrategias híbridas. La clave está en asignar a cada herramienta el rol que maximice productividad y gobernanza.